zyroqperiod 1
    Updated 2024-12-28
    SELECT
    DATE_TRUNC('{{granularity }}', BLOCK_TIMESTAMP) AS date,
    CASE
    WHEN PLATFORM ILIKE 'trader-joe%' THEN 'trader-joe'
    WHEN PLATFORM ILIKE 'hashflow%' THEN 'hashflow'
    WHEN PLATFORM ILIKE 'kyberswap%' THEN 'kyberswap'
    WHEN PLATFORM ILIKE 'pharaoh%' THEN 'pharaoh'
    WHEN PLATFORM ILIKE 'uniswap%' THEN 'uniswap'
    ELSE PLATFORM
    END AS platform_group,
    sum(AMOUNT_IN_USD) as volume,
    count(DISTINCT ORIGIN_FROM_ADDRESS) as swappers,
    count(DISTINCT TX_HASH) as swap,
    FROM avalanche.defi.ez_dex_swaps
    WHERE block_timestamp > CURRENT_DATE - INTERVAL '{{trading_period}} days'
    group by 1,2
    QueryRunArchived: QueryRun has been archived